Birdman And B.G. Dissing Turk At Cash Money 30 Years Anniversary Show In Chicago (video)

In a remarkable celebration of hip-hop history, Cash Money Records marked its 30th anniversary with a star-studded show in Chicago, where legendary figures Birdman and B.G. took center stage. The event not only highlighted the label’s legacy but also stirred the pot of nostalgia and rivalry within the hip-hop community, particularly involving Turk, a former member of the Hot Boys collective.

The atmosphere was electric as fans gathered to witness the reunion of iconic artists who have shaped the rap scene over three decades. Birdman, co-founder of Cash Money Records, expressed gratitude for the journey and the sacrifices made to achieve the label’s success. His passion for the music and the brand was palpable as he took the stage, engaging the audience with powerful performances that spanned years of hits.

During the event, Birdman and B.G. did not shy away from addressing their history with Turk, whose departure from the group has been a point of contention.
